Just wanted to toss out this combo that I'm looking at trying with one of my characters for you to look at...



Master Commando


4:0:0:4 Teras Kasi (Med and melee defense)


4:3:1:2 Carbineer



Maybe if I discover that the defensive bonus in Teras Kasi isn't worth it I'll drop that line and add more to the Carbineer tree.



What I'm going for here... Well, I don't particularly want to melee with this character, and I think that the Carbineer has some of the most promising mid-range skills out there. It gets a nice ranged knockdown, some impressive bleeds, but most importantly good area effect and cone attacks. This is the kind of guy who can sit in a defensive position all day and kill groups of enemies that try to enter. Anyone gets too close and they get roasted.


Any opinions on the feasibility of this setup?

A couple of things....


The area effect cone KD of carbineers is broken, and doesn't knockdown. Carbineers really don't fly through their HAM as fast as everyone says.....no wait, yes they do =). Fortunately popping a tatooine sunburn before battle pretty much eliminates your HAM problems. Honestly though, with Master Commando, you've got plenty of firepower, and the only reason I could see taking Carbineer would be status effects/KD's/etc. The one ranged KD that DOES work is awesome. It has an awful animation that makes you stand to use it, but it has no knockdown timer, which allows you to spam it with reckless abandon and as long as the KD keeps hitting, you're cool. The full-auto carbine shots have a chance to stun/blind/dizzy with every hit, which is EXTREMELY useful. The dizzy very rarely sticks, but you'll stun and blind pretty much everything you shoot. The first action bleed includes a posture component, which is fairly spiffy for nailing opponents that are moving out of your flamethrower range, but the second one is both cone and a posture down, making it very useful in limited situations, and just awful in others. Finally, leg shot 3 doesn't really do much more damagethan leg shot 2, and has quite a bit higher HAM cost, so don't get that line expecting a great upgrade there.


The defensive acuity bonuses from TKA will only work when unarmed, you would be better off taking the melee damage mitigation line (balance I believe). The melee and ranged defense bonuses would be good, sure, but you can get skilltapes or armor attachments to raise those skills, and melee damage mitigation is just too awesome to miss out on.


So, in conclusion, do whatever you feel is fun, this could be a good build, but experiment with it before making any big decisions.

Smuggler 0040 would be a good addition.

First you get Feign Death, which allows you to fake incapacitation and you can not be deathblown.

Then, you get panic shot. With panic shot, you fire several shots in a cone in front of you, delaying every target for ten seconds. This works REALLY good when you're up close. After you hit this, you flame cone and run away .

Then, you get Low Blow. Ranged KD. Nuff said

Not sure about Last Ditch, pretty sure it's a high damage attack. If they nerf flame DOT, it might be good to combine with low-blow as a finishing move.

My main doubt with this lies in the area of flexibility. Frankly, I don't know how often I would need to use a carbine, given the normal Commando weaponry. It might be that a melee skill would be more useful, but if I did that I couldn't take anything but TKA very far.


In terms of ranged skills, I'm looking at Carbine simply because it has the most flexible utilities. Lots of area effects with specials applied very quickly, combined with some nice bleeds and a bit of a knockdown capability - plus it fires fairly quickly. Rifleman, when not mastered(and I won't have the points for that), is just simply too slow for firing. Pistols are nice for Dodge, but quite frankly I'd rather have a little more meat to my shooting.


So what I'm looking at isthe heavy weapons/pistolat extreme range, carbine at medium, the Flamethrower at short, and TKA at point blank range. I rather expect that I'd be able to make a helluva dent in almost anything given that sort of structure.


So, given that I cannot do Rifle because it'd be too slow, is there a way to tweak this to make it a little more effective?

I hear the meditation line is extremely useful, in TKA.






As a TKM I can confirm this. I can cure both poison and disease, as well as heal my own wounds. That includes mind wounds I don't need medics, doctors or entertainers to heal anymore. Well, I can't get rid of my own BF but still...


Then there's Power Boost and Force of Will. With Power Boost I can buff my HAM pools by 50% of my Mind. With Force of Will I have a chance of getting up from incapacitation almost immediately. Yes, Meditation is very useful
